I judged Babylon’s archive design differently once I timed the review process instead of only counting copies.@BabylonLabs_io

The obvious metric is 3,000 backups. It sounds resilient. But one minute per recovery check turns that archive into 50 hours of continuous verification. Even 1,500 copies still need 25 hours, more than three eight-hour shifts.

That changes operator behavior.

Do teams inspect every copy, or sample a few and assume the rest are healthy? Who verifies the final copies after fatigue, interruptions, or a failed check halfway through? BABY may inherit strong redundancy on paper while the human review layer becomes selective.

Some duplication is reasonable. Three copies can protect against local loss, damaged media, and failed restores.

The real test is infrastructure power vs operational accessibility. If 3,000 copies represent only 1,000 logical relationships, Babylon has tripled the verification burden from 16 hours 40 minutes to 50 hours without tripling unique information.

Maybe automation closes that gap. Still, automated logs are not the same as proven recoverability.

I’m watching whether Babylon can compress verification work, not only storage risk. An archive is resilient only when operators can repeatedly prove it works, not when they simply possess more copies.
